Drake Maye Leads 2025 NFL MVP Odds (-400)
Drake Maye has seized firm control of the MVP race, sitting at -400 odds, which translates to an implied 80% chance of winning the award.
Maye’s odds are stronger than Matthew Stafford ever reached during the MVP watch period this season. Coming off a dominant stretch — including a five-touchdown performance — Maye has positioned himself as the clear frontrunner heading into the final week.
Barring an unexpected collapse, the MVP is essentially Maye’s award to lose. If he delivers a solid, representative showing against the Dolphins on Sunday, voters are expected to reward him with the league’s highest individual honor.
Matthew Stafford Still Alive, But Needs a Miracle (+300)
Matthew Stafford opened last week as the MVP favorite, but a three-interception performance in a loss to the Falcons dramatically shifted the landscape.
Now priced at +300, Stafford must overcome multiple obstacles:
- A massive performance in Week 18
- Drake Maye underperforming against Miami
- Uncertainty about how much Stafford will even play
Rams head coach Sean McVay has indicated some starters may play, but Los Angeles has historically rested key players when only playoff seeding is at stake. If Stafford does see the field, he likely needs his best game of the season to regain momentum with MVP voters.
